It's true - when Yorkies are teething, their ears will go up and down. I believe it's because there is reduced calcium in the cartilage that holds the ears up. When we got Coby, both ears were up on their own. A week or so later, one went down. When it went back up, the other went down. Before long they were both up. Very few Yorkies' ears don't go up on their own (and those that don't are just as cute in a different way). We had the taping instructions all printed out but never needed them. I'm betting they'll go up just fine. You can also trim or shave the hair on the ears to make them less heavy and able to stand up more easily. Are you keeping her ears shaved? Excess hair can also cause them to fall back down because of the weight of the hair. |
